I am writing a program that require user to choose whether to enter in hexadecimal form or in normal form. The 'while" is to check whether the user enter the correct key or not. If not, then it will always prompt the user.
My problem is why the while does not break away even i enter the correct key ( y or n )??
Can anyone help me with this.
Code://Ask user whether to input in hexadecimal form or not int hex; printf("Do you want to input in Hexdecimal? Y/N : "); hex = getchar(); while( hex != 'y' || hex != 'n'|| hex != 'Y' || hex != 'N') { printf("Please enter Y or N only!\n"); hex = getchar(); } //-------------------------------------------------------- //if user input 'Y' or 'y' then proceed with the following if(hex == 'Y' || hex == 'y') { printf("Please enter in hexadecimal form : \n"); hexadecimal = getchar(); while(hexadecimal != '\n') { if('0' <= hexadecimal && hexadecimal <= '9') { decimal = decimal * 16; decimal = decimal + (hexadecimal - '0'); } else if('A' <= hexadecimal && hexadecimal <= 'F') { decimal = decimal * 16; decimal = decimal + (hexadecimal - 'A')+10; } else if('a' <= hexadecimal && hexadecimal <= 'f') { decimal = decimal * 16; decimal = decimal + (hexadecimal - 'a')+10; } else { break; } count++; i++; hexadecimal = getchar(); } printf("The decimal for hexadecimal is : %d\n",decimal); }
